Daredevil: Born Again Release Date Details

The series kicks off on March 4, 2025. Fans will get a special treat with a two-episode premiere. Also, both episodes will be available at 9:00 P.M. ET. This is also 6:00 P.M. PT. Moreover, this early release gives fans a chance to dive right into the story of Matt Murdock once again.

Where to Watch the Previous “Daredevil” Series

For those wanting to watch the original Daredevil series from Netflix, it is now streaming on Disney+. Also, the entire Defenders franchise, including Jessica Jones, Luke Cage, and Iron Fist, is also available on Disney+. Thus, fans can relive the stories of these characters. Confirmation of Daredevil: Born Again Season 2

Exciting news arrives for fans looking ahead. Daredevil: Born Again has already been confirmed for a second season. Also, production for Season 2 is underway. This ensures that more adventures of Matt Murdock will come after the first season ends.
